    Dystrophin Genotype and Risk of Neuropsychiatric Disorders in Dystrophinopathies: A Systematic Review and Meta-Analysis

    No full text
    Background: Dystrophinopathies are associated with neuropsychiatric disorders due to alterations in dystrophin/DMD expression. Objective: The objective was to estimate the association of developmental disorders, autism spectrum disorders (ASD), attention deficit hyperactivity disorder (ADHD), depression, anxiety disorders, and obsessive-compulsive disorder with the dystrophin/DMD genotype in population with dystrophinopathies. Methods: Systematic searches of Medline, Scopus, Web of Science, and Cochrane Library were performed from inception to September 2022. We included observational studies in the population with Becker or Duchenne muscular dystrophies (BMD, DMD) that estimated the prevalence of these disorders according to Dp140 and/or Dp71 genotype. Meta-analysis of the prevalence ratio (PR) of genotype comparisons was conducted for each disorder. Results: Ten studies were included in the systematic review. In BMD, Dp140+ vs. Dp140- and Dp71+ vs. Dp71- were associated with developmental disorders with a PR of 0.11 (0.04, 0.34) and 0.22 (0.07, 0.67), respectively. In DMD, Dp140+/Dp71+ vs. Dp140-/Dp71- had a PR of 0.40 (0.28, 0.57), and Dp71+ vs. Dp71- had a PR of 0.47 (0.36, 0.63) for ADHD. However, there was no association of genotype with ASD, only a trend was observed for Dp71+ vs. Dp71-, with a PR of 0.61 (0.35, 1.06). Moreover, the data showed no association of these isoforms with emotional-related disorders. Conclusions: In BMD, Dp140 and Dp71 could be associated with developmental disorders, whileADHDmight be associated with the Dp71 genotype in DMD.     Application of nanocomposites in integrated photocatalytic techniques for water pollution remediation

    No full text
    In recent years, photocatalysis integrated with other water purification technique is emerging to decontaminate the polluted water effectively. Herein, a focus on adsorptive photocatalysis, photo-Fenton, photo–electrocatalysis, photocatalytic ozonation, sono-photocatalysis and photo–piezocatalytic techniques developed for degradation of organic water pollutants has been provided. Specifically, application of nanocomposites in the degradation of different organic pollutants (dyes, pesticides, antibiotics, phenolic compounds etc.,) via integrated photocatalysis was reviewed. The catalytic performances of different nanocomposites along with the experimental parameters such as dosage, light source, irradiation time, pollutant’ concentration was summarized. Photocatalysis integrated with multiple techniques was also introduced. Current challenges, future perspectives and conclusion of this literature survey have been briefed.     When non-target wildlife species and alien species both affect negatively to an artisanal fishery: the case of trammel net in the Alboran Sea

    No full text
    In the Northern Alboran Sea, artisanal small-scale fisheries using trammel nets suffer economic losses, and local fishermen see their way-of-life endangered, due to interactions with wildlife species such as alien species and dolphins. On the one hand, the alien seaweed Rugulopteryx okamurae, which was first recorded in the Alboran Sea in 2015, has undergone an intensive expansion in the sub-region, monopolizing the available seabed, causing radical changes in the underwater seascape and clogging the trammel nets. On the other hand, the damage caused to the fishing nets by dolphin fish predation is an ancient problem worldwide, but it is intensifying in the last years. The main objective of this study is to understand the main environmental and technical conditions that favor damages of fishing trammel nets in the Alboran Sea, which entails an important loss of catchability, due to (i) the clogging of the artisanal fishing trammel nets by invasive seaweed, and (ii) the breaking of the nets by dolphin predation. Through close monitoring of fishermen in port, we obtained direct information of 548 sets. Our results indicate that approximately 30% of trammel sets suffered a damage due to unwanted interaction with alien seaweeds and dolphins.     The European Union's Preferential Trade Agreements: between convergence and differentiation

    No full text
    Gone are the days when tariff liberalization was the centre of the European Union’s Preferential Trade Agreements (EU PTAs). Instead, the current generation of EU PTAs manages trade from a regulatory perspective: they establish rules that apply to domestic measures. Significantly, EU PTAs deploy international standards rather than EU law to regulate trade, directly influencing the speed of regulatory convergence with its treaty partners. Though EU PTAs aim to boost trade through regulatory convergence, they also consider the specific conditions of the EU’s treaty partner. This article analyses this regulatory turn in the EU’s PTAs, its practice and its consequences regarding trade and sustainable development. © The Author(s) 2023. Published by Oxford University Press.     Iridoid esters from Valeriana pavonii Poepp. & Endl. as GABAA modulators: Structural insights in their binding mode and structure-activity relationship

    No full text
    Context: Valeriana pavonii Poepp. & Endl. (Caprifoliaceae), is a plant used in traditional medicine as a tranquilizer in Colombia. Valerian extracts have been widely used since ancient times for their sedative and anxiolytic properties; however, the way its active metabolites, including iridoids, interact on their respective targets is not fully understood. Aims: To isolate and identificate active iridoid esters from V. pavonii. Perform in vitro inhibition assays and computational analyses to study their possible interaction on the benzodiazepine site of the GABAA receptor. Methods: Two compounds were obtained from dichloromethane and petroleum ether fractions of V. pavonii, respectively, by chromatographic techniques. The structural elucidation was performed by NMR and spectroscopic analyses. In vitro inhibition assays of the binding of 3H-flunitrazepam (3H-FNZ) for the benzodiazepine binding site of the GABAA receptor (BDZ-bs of the GABAA receptor) were carried out. Results: Two iridoid esters, hydrine-type valepotriates (compounds 1 and 2), were reported for the first time in V. pavonii. Both iridoids, 1 and 2, inhibited the binding of 3H-FNZ on the BDZ-bs of the GABAA receptor (40% at 300 μM). Docking studies and MMGBSA calculations revealed that these compounds exhibited molecular interactions with crucial residues of the benzodiazepine site, similar to those observed for drugs like flunitrazepam, diazepam, and flumazenil.     Validity and reliability of the International fItness scale (IFIS) in preschool children

    No full text
    Objectives: Examine the validity and reliability of parent-reported International FItness Scale (IFIS) in preschoolers. Method: A cross-sectional study of 3051 Spanish preschoolers (3–5 years). Fitness was measured by PREFIT battery and reported by parents using an adapted version of the IFIS. Waist circumference was evaluated, and the waist-to-height ratio (WHtR) was calculated. Seventy-six parents of randomly selected schoolchildren completed the IFIS twice for a reliability assessment. Results: ANCOVA, adjusted for sex, age and WHtR, showed that preschoolers who were scored by their parents as having average-to-very good fitness had better levels of measured physical fitness than those preschoolers who were classified as having “very poor/poor” fitness levels (18.1laps to 22.1laps vs 15.6laps for cardiorespiratory fitness; 6.6 kg to 7.5 kg vs 5.3 kg for muscular fitness-handgrip-; 71.7 cm to 76.4 cm vs 62.0 cm for muscular fitness-standing long jump-; 17.2s to 16.2s vs 18.2s for speed/agility; and 11.2s to 15.6s vs 8.7s for balance; p < 0.001). The weighted kappa for concordance between parent-reported fitness levels and objective assessment was poor (κ ≤ 0.18 for all fitness measures). Overall, the mean values of the abdominal adiposity indicators were significantly lower in high-level fitness categories reported by parents than in low-level fitness categories (p < 0.05). The test-retest reliability ranged from 0.46 to 0.62. Conclusions: The reliability of the parent-reported IFIS are acceptable, but the concordance between parents reported and objectively measures fitness levels is poor, suggesting that parents’ responses may not be able to correctly classify preschoolers according to their fitness level. Highlights The convergent validity and reliability (test-retest) values of the IFIS parent scale are moderately acceptable for assessing physical fitness in children aged 3–5 years. However, the results of concordance show that criterion validity is poor suggesting that parents’ responses may not be able to correctly classify preschoolers according to their fitness level. Considering that the fitness level at these ages is fairly homogeneous, it seems difficult for parents to discriminate between the fitness levels of their children.     Protective Effects of Flavonoid Rutin Against Aminochrome Neurotoxicity

    No full text
    Causes of dopaminergic neuronal loss in Parkinson’s disease (PD) are subject of investigation and the common use of models of acute neurodegeneration induced by neurotoxins 1-methyl-4-phenyl-1,2,3,6-tetrahydropyridine (MPTP), 6-hydroxydopamine, and rotenone contributed to advances in the study of PD. However, the use of study models more similar to the pathophysiology of PD is required for advances in early diagnosis and translational pharmacology. Aminochrome (AMI), a compound derived from dopamine oxidation and a precursor of neuromelanin, is able to induce all the mechanisms associated with neurodegeneration. Previously, we showed AMI is cytotoxic in primary culture of mesencephalic cells (PCMC) and induces in vitro and in vivo neuroinflammation. On the other hand, the effect of rutin in central nervous system cells has revealed anti-inflammatory, antioxidative, and neuroprotective potential. However, there have been no data studies on the effect of rutin against aminochrome neurotoxicity. Here, we show that rutin prevents lysosomal dysfunction and aminochrome-induced cell death in SHSY-5Y cells, protects PCMC against aminochrome cytotoxicity, and prevents in vivo loss of dopaminergic neurons in substantia nigra pars compacta (SNPc), as well as microgliosis and astrogliosis. Additionally, we show that rutin decreases levels of interleukin-1β (IL-1β) mRNA and increases levels of glia-derived neurotrophic factor (GDNF) and nerve-derived neurotrophic factor (NGF) mRNA.     Compassion in health professionals: Development and validation of the Capacity for Compassion Scale

    No full text
    Background: Health professionals witness pain and suffering when they care for sick people and their families. Compassion is a necessary quality in their work as it combines the will to help, alleviate suffering and promote the well-being of both the people they are attending and the professionals themselves. The aim of the study was to design and evaluate the psychometric properties of the Capacity for Compassion Scale (CCS). Design: A quantitative, descriptive and cross-sectional study was carried out to evaluate the psychometric properties of the scale (reliability, temporal stability, content validity, criterion validity and construct validity). Methods: The study was carried out in two phases: pilot study and final validation. The data were collected between April and May 2022. The sample was selected by convenience sampling and was made up of a total of 264 participants, 59 in the pilot phase and 205 in the final validation. Results: The Capacity for Compassion Scale has been shown to have good psychometric properties in relation to reliability, temporal stability, and content, criterion, and construct validity. Factor analysis showed that there were four subdimensions of the scale: motivation/commitment, presence, shared humanity and self-compassion. The results also indicate that compassionate ability is significantly correlated with age and work experience. Conclusions: The Capacity for Compassion Scale shows adequate psychometric properties. This instrument measures the compassion capacity of health professionals, which is a valuable discovery for new lines of research in this field. Impact: Through this scale, low levels of capacity for compassion can be detected that negatively influence the quality of care provided by health professionals. The Capacity for Compassion Scale can therefore contribute to the identification of needs and promote training around compassion for health professionals.     Statistics and probability in Spanish and Chilean pre-school and primary school textbooks

    No full text
    This article seeks to identify the epistemic suitability, linked to statistics and probability, of the textbooks for Pre-school and Primary Education in Spain and Chile. Theoretical and methodological elements of Didactic Suitability are used, specifically, the epistemic facet. A content analysis of eight Chilean and Spanish textbooks is carried out. In both countries, the most frequent problem situation is the interpretation of representations and the construction of graphs and statistical tables.     Mapping the Circular Economy in the Small and Medium-sized Enterprises field: An exploratory network analysis

    No full text
    The literature on the Circular Economy (CE) has shown considerable expansion over recent years, with various studies striving to guide corporate entities in transitioning from linear to circular production paradigms. While larger businesses and multinational corporations have been a central focus, a significant gap exists in understanding the transformation journey of Small and Medium-sized Enterprises (SMEs) towards circularity. This research aims to enhance the existing body of knowledge by mapping the knowledge at the intersection of SMEs and the CE. This study utilizes an exploratory approach and leverages network analysis and content analysis to scrutinize 126 academic papers indexed on Scopus. The findings indicate that the field is bifurcated into nascent and early-growth stages. Although CE appears as the prevalent theme in most of the papers surveyed, an emerging group of academics has begun to delve into the domain of SMEs and CE. Further to identifying thematic clusters, this research explores the main references from these two phases by exploring their contents.
